This file acts as a set of instructions, telling the game engine exactly where to look for .package files and how many sub-folders deep it should search. Without it, the game will ignore any custom hairstyles, furniture, or gameplay overhauls you've added. How to Install and Set Up Resource.cfg
If you have two mods that edit the same quest or same piece of clothing, the one loaded last wins. Mods are loaded in the order the file system returns them (usually alphabetical). You cannot easily change load order via resource.cfg (unlike Skyrim ’s plugin system), but you can create subfolders named 01_Core , 02_Overrides , etc., to force alphabetical loading.
